On Thursday shares of Cytori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:CYTX) closed at $0.69. Company’s sales growth for last 5 years was -12.40%. On May 05, Cytori Therapeutics (NASDAQ: CYTX) announced the pricing of a registered direct public offering of Units, with each Unit consisting of one share of our common stock and one warrant to purchase one share of common stock. The sale of the Units is expected to take place in two separate closings. In the first closing (the Initial Closing), which we expect to occur on or about May 8, 2015, the Company will sell Units having gross proceeds of $19.4 million.

Nortel Inversora S.A. (NYSE:NTL) has 12.12% insider ownership while its institutional ownership stands at 6.90%. In last trading activity company’s stock closed at $20.55. On May 5, Nortel Inversora S.A. (NYSE:NTL) informs that Telecom has repurchased 15,221,373 of its own stock as of March 31, 2015. As a result, the political and economic rights of Nortel have increased to 55.60 % of Telecom’s outstanding stock as of such date.

On last trading day LightPath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:LPTH) advanced 0.85% to close at $1.18. Its volatility for the week is 6.39% while volatility for the month is 8.53%. LPTH’s sales growth for past 5 years was 9.50% and its EPS growth for past 5 years was 49.70%. LightPath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:LPTH) monthly performance is 19.55%. LightPath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:LPTH) announced financial results for the fiscal 2015 third quarter ended March 31, 2015. Revenue for the third quarter of fiscal 2015 totaled approximately $3.2 million, which was an increase of $193,000, or 6%, as compared to the same period of the prior fiscal year. The increase from the third quarter of the prior fiscal year is attributable to an increase in sales of specialty products and an increase in sales of infrared products.
